diff options
author | 2015-05-18 21:29:39 +0000 | |
---|---|---|
committer | 2015-05-18 21:29:39 +0000 | |
commit | 699a32bcdfaf0390a269a275b979d46ca815654a (patch) | |
tree | 45400462ffcc7b25e6862d1d22d0723bf2de606d /libs/gui/ConsumerBase.cpp | |
parent | bfb1f1cc832840b7232c25a91d49eb39aa79687f (diff) | |
parent | 847f11e215e86b107ab50c1359fc7bc3cd7a3a11 (diff) |
Merge "Refactor ConsumerBase and it's derived classes." into mnc-dev
Diffstat (limited to 'libs/gui/ConsumerBase.cpp')
-rw-r--r-- | libs/gui/ConsumerBase.cpp | 16 |
1 files changed, 16 insertions, 0 deletions
diff --git a/libs/gui/ConsumerBase.cpp b/libs/gui/ConsumerBase.cpp index 0e42daf613..04ab06b557 100644 --- a/libs/gui/ConsumerBase.cpp +++ b/libs/gui/ConsumerBase.cpp @@ -198,6 +198,22 @@ status_t ConsumerBase::detachBuffer(int slot) { return result; } +status_t ConsumerBase::setDefaultBufferSize(uint32_t width, uint32_t height) { + Mutex::Autolock _l(mMutex); + return mConsumer->setDefaultBufferSize(width, height); +} + +status_t ConsumerBase::setDefaultBufferFormat(PixelFormat defaultFormat) { + Mutex::Autolock _l(mMutex); + return mConsumer->setDefaultBufferFormat(defaultFormat); +} + +status_t ConsumerBase::setDefaultBufferDataSpace( + android_dataspace defaultDataSpace) { + Mutex::Autolock _l(mMutex); + return mConsumer->setDefaultBufferDataSpace(defaultDataSpace); +} + void ConsumerBase::dump(String8& result) const { dump(result, ""); } |